About Zip Code 07675
Zip code 07675 is located in River Vale, New Jersey, within Bergen County. Home to approximately 27,050 residents, this area sits at an elevation of 48 ft and falls within the Eastern (EST/EDT) timezone. The local area code is 973.
The median household income is $176,981 per year, which is above the national median of $70,784. Homes in this zip code have a median value of $680,600, and the cost of living index is 230 (130% above the national average of 100).
Summers average a high of 86°F while winters drop to 23°F. The area receives about 51 in of rain and 33 in of snow annually. The zip code covers 9.6 square miles of land area and 1.1 square miles of water.
